Features:
  • Fifteen Super Bright 20,000 MCD LED Lights, nine for lighting a large area and six emergency flashers
  • Cell Phone Charger
  • High-quality, long range AM/FM radio with external speaker. MP3 Speaker Play through connection
  • 130 decibel Signaling Siren for Emergencies
  • Crank Power with optional DC Car Adapter, AAA Batteries and AC Adapter

Product Description
Life Gears Light3 has the power of 3 lights in 1. The light acts as a lantern, a flashlight and a flasher in a single item! The Light3 has dual power options. Power is delivered either by the crank or by alkaline battery. The lights superbright 0.5 watt LED is visible over 1 mile away. With its contemporary proprietary design, the Light3 is ideal for household use, camping or emergencies. The Light3 provides attractive and useful features that can be used daily while having components that can be potentially life saving during time of need.

2 out of 5 stars isolation outdoors product, not for hurricane   September 16, 2008
  1 out of 1 found this review helpful

I have model LL01 purchased sometimes in 2005 or 6. First use of this was in Hurricane Ike in 2008, during total blackout. Very disappointed.

The radio was grossly inadequate. I could hear better with my high-quality pocket radio. The siren is so weak--better to shout.

The light was amusing. It's extremely bright LED, as long as it has enough power. However, one look into this destroys one's night vision. Additionaly, takes a lot of constant cranking to retain good lighting.

There are some good uses of this light, and I found one of these. Suppose one wants a light to hang on a tree to act as a beacon for the campground. Surprisingly, this light will emit light for a long period of time, and in pitch darkness, with good night vision, one can see this from some distance (I suspect). Problem is, it doesn't have a hanger to hang onto a tree for this purpose.

Also, using its low light setting, this light can last nearly all night. This unit served comparably to a hallway night light for me during the hurricane.

Also, I imagine, if you're being rescued in the dark, the other light settings can be useful.
